Former Abercrombie CEO Mike Jeffries arrested in sex trafficking case

  • Former Abercrombie & Fitch CEO Mike Jeffries has been arrested on sex trafficking charges, according to a spokesperson for federal prosecutors.
  • His partner, Matthew Smith, and a third man, James Jacobson, have also been arrested for the same charges.
  • The FBI investigation followed claims of sexual exploitation and abuse by Jeffries and Smith at events they hosted worldwide.
